Amanda Marie Grefstad has written her name into Norwegian athletics history with a remarkable performance at the Folksam Grand Prix in Gothenburg, where she shattered the national women’s 1000m record in spectacular fashion.
Grefstad stopped the clock at 2:37.19, producing a sensational run that not only delivered a Norwegian record but also brought down a mark that had stood untouched for an astonishing 45 years.
The significance of the performance goes far beyond the numbers. For nearly half a century, the old national record had remained one of the most enduring benchmarks in Norwegian middle-distance running. Now, Grefstad has finally rewritten the record books, replacing a piece of athletics history with her own name.
Her 2:37.19 performance was a powerful demonstration of speed, strength and determination, highlighting the progress she has made and the growing level of Norwegian middle-distance running.
